If you think your ISP is blocking 3rd party DNS, then DoT will be very easy for them to block. I would stick with DoH. I would also advise either using the config file on your iPhone or the app.... not both. One thing you could try is to start fresh with your phone by deleting all the profiles that have been installed and create new ones.

Settings > VPN - for your WS VPN profile/s, click on the little i icon and click delete in the popup. Do so for all profiles.

Settings > General > VPN & Device Management - Delete the Configuration Profile.

See if your phone works with the Wifi. Do not use a VPN. If it's working OK, then reintroduce Control D by reinstalling the config file. Do not use the app. If that's working, then try a Windscribe connection.

In my experience, Wireguard or OpenVPN are stable. IKEv2 has been problematic for me. It seems to be fine but soon starts disconnecting and for one of my devices, I lost internet connectivity with it until I switched to Wireguard. Be careful with 'Always on VPN' and 'Circumvent Censorship' options. Use them only if you have to ... not because they seem nice to enable. They add layers of complexity that are worth it only if it's the only way to get a VPN connection going.

I was asking Barry about this very same thing.

I was experiencing miserable Youtube performance while redirected through Albania. This was while using the ControlD app and DoH3 on my devices. Once I disabled the ControlD app on my devices, and for DNS, used my home-internet router configured to use ControlD and DoT, Youtube worked a lot better. Something was definitely different, though I didn't really expect it.

I then removed the ControlD app from all my devices and installed ControlD profiles so they use DoH and not DoH3. Again, performance was better than with the app and DoH3, but I don't think quite as good as with DoT.

Barry claims that the routing of requests etc. differ depending on whether you're using DoH, DoT or DoH3, and that these differences could affect streaming performance. I can't recall all the convoluted explanations, but the point was made. My observations weren't coincidence or by chance.

So I've now decided to no longer use DoH3 on my devices and stick to DoH. Youtube is again working without issue.

I assume you're aware that Apple has purchased exclusive televising rights of the F1 Championship starting 2026 through to 2029. This means that F1 in the USA will be watchable only through AppleTV.

If you try to watch using the F1TV app and you have a USA based F1TV subscription, or try to watch via a USA IP, then it will not work.

You will need an F1TV account with an address based in one of the country's whose televising rights allow F1TV Pro streaming. With ControlD, you can then DNS redirect, but ideally through the same country to prevent potential problems. If there's a disparity detected, it will often not work. One common disparity is that your F1TV account country address is different from that of the connecting IP.

Control D filters domain lookup requests coming from your device. It will not be able to tell whether each request is from the same app or even for the same website within your browser. I don’t see how it will. 

This is why browser level filtering works better in such situations. 

If you are the only user of the Control D profile, then you can temporarily disable filtering.  You can find this by scrolling to the bottom of your profile options and toggle the disable switch. You can use the timer to disable filtering for a set period of time.
